Supercharge Your Blog’s SEO with RSS Feeds

What Are RSS Feeds and Why Should You Care?

RSS stands for Really Simple Syndication. It’s like a behind-the-scenes news ticker
that keeps your subscribers updated on new content. Think of it as a friendly messenger
delivering fresh posts right to their inbox.

When you use RSS feeds, you’re not just sharing your content. You’re also making it
easier for search engines to find and index your blog. This helps you climb the SEO
ladder, getting you noticed by more people.

Optimize Your RSS Feed for SEO

Now that you see the benefits, let’s get into the nitty-gritty of optimizing your RSS
feed for SEO:

Use Relevant Keywords

Just like in your blog content, using keywords in your RSS feed is crucial. Incorporate
relevant keywords in your feed title and description. This tells search engines what
your content is about, making it more likely to show up in search results. It’s like
putting up a sign that says, “Hey, look over here!”

Include Eye-Catching Titles and Descriptions

First impressions matter. Make sure your feed titles and descriptions are engaging and
descriptive. The more appealing your content sounds, the more likely someone will click
through to read more. Think of it like a movie trailer—make people want to see the
whole show!

Promote Your RSS Feed

Don’t keep your RSS feed a secret! Promote it on your blog, social media, and
newsletters. Encourage your readers to subscribe. You could even include a
call-to-action like, “Stay updated! Subscribe to our RSS feed for the latest
posts!” This is like opening the doors and inviting everyone in.

Utilize RSS Feed Readers and Aggregators

There are plenty of RSS readers out there like Feedly or Inoreader. Angle your
blog posts for these platforms by making sure your RSS feed is compatible. This
widens your exposure and connects your content with a broader audience. Imagine
throwing a party—more friends mean more fun!

Measure Your Success

Like any good strategy, measuring results is key. Use analytics to track how many
people are engaging with your RSS feed. This data helps you understand what’s working
and what’s not. It’s like checking your scores after a game—it shows you where to
focus for improvement.
